When it comes to the foundations of math, I have trouble trying to get very far beyond the feelings and impressions I have when doing math. It feels as if mathematical objects have some kind of independent existence --and I don't know what to say beyond that. When I construct a proof, I see myself as arranging symbols according to formal rules (although the written version of the proof is in a shorthand as a full formal proof of any complexity would be unreadable). The Intuitionist idea (as I understand it) that math takes place inside the human brain feels correct too, but I don't agree with most of the conclusions that Intuitionists derive from this. All of these views co-exist rather peacefully in my more or less unexamined thoughts about what math is

Am I characterizing your position correctly? Well, I think W. was arguing against Platonism in mathematics. That's subtly different from saying that math argument does not do a good or reliable job of establishing "truth" (i.e. reality)[*]. But, basically, yes. I think if pressed, W. would agree with your statement. He would actually go far far beyond your statement and say that math is a pathological perversion of thought. Indeed, it is a dangerous and misleading perversion (though it may be effective in highly skilled hands). The point W was trying to make was that to fixate on math and elevate it to science is a grave mistake. Doing so will prevent you from learning how the world really works. To be clear, my position is different from W's. I think math is related to reality because we (biological animals) invented math as a way to help us navigate the world. I think there are both evolutionary and psychological justifications for the relationship between reality and math. [*] We have to be careful to distinguish between the validity of a statement and the soundness of a statement. Validity has to do with whether or not a statement is mathematically well-formed. If it is (and if the language is complete), then it is either true or false.
